Every individual is continually exerting himself to find out the most advantageous employment for whatever capital he can comman

d. It is his own advantage, indeed, and not that of the society which he has in view. But the study of his own advantage naturally leads him to prefer that employment which is most advantageous to the society.
Read the quotation by Adam Smith.

According to this quote, what motivates most individuals?

desire for power
concern for others
competition for jobs
sense of self-interest

Answer:

sense of self-interest.

Explanation:

The given quote is taken from the book titled 'The Wealth of Nation' written by Adam Smith. The book is about the free-market economics and it's pros and cons to the economy.

In the given quote, Adam Smith is talking about that it is <em>sense of self-interest</em> that motivates people to seek high-paying jobs rather than the desire of interest of society. He asserts that people are exerting themselves to seek high-paying jobs for his own advantage than advantage to the society.

Therefore, option D is correct.

What element of the federal government is established by Article III of the Constitution?
mote1985 [20]
<span>Article III of the Constitution establishes the judicial branch of the federal government. This article grants the judicial power of the government to the Supreme Court and allows inferior courts that Congress may create from time to time. It also explains the powers of federal courts and specifies treason.</span>
